Pulling your hair out can be a sign of a condition called Trichotillomania, a compulsion to pull out hair. It’s important to seek help from a medical professional if this behavior is affecting your daily life. They can provide the right diagnosis and treatment options to manage it effectively.

FAQs & Answers

  1. What causes Trichotillomania? Trichotillomania can be caused by a combination of genetic, environmental, and psychological factors.
  2. How is Trichotillomania treated? Treatment options include therapy, support groups, and sometimes medication to help manage impulses.
  3. Is hair pulling a sign of a mental condition? Yes, pulling hair can indicate an underlying mental health condition like Trichotillomania.
  4. Can I manage Trichotillomania on my own? While some strategies may help, it is important to seek professional help for effective management.
